1. The Sixth Sense (1999)
Director: M. Night Shyamalan
Genre: Supernatural Thriller
Often considered the gold standard in twist endings, The Sixth Sense isn’t just about the twist—it’s about how the story builds toward it so seamlessly. With haunting atmosphere, emotional depth, and a performance by Bruce Willis that holds up even on rewatch, the film takes you on a quiet, chilling journey that ends with a revelation most people never saw coming.
It’s a twist that doesn’t just shock—it redefines everything.
2. Fight Club (1999)
Director: David Fincher
Genre: Psychological Drama / Thriller
Fight Club is a gritty, anarchistic exploration of masculinity, identity, and rebellion. But underneath all the chaos is a brilliantly hidden secret that reshapes the narrative once revealed. It’s more than a twist—it’s a commentary on how perception can be manipulated, both in film and in real life.
It’s smart, stylish, and the kind of twist that makes you want to rewatch the entire movie with fresh eyes.
3. Gone Girl (2014)
Director: David Fincher
Genre: Psychological Thriller / Mystery
David Fincher makes the list again with Gone Girl, a film that keeps you guessing from start to finish. Based on Gillian Flynn’s bestselling novel, the story unfolds like a mystery, but what lies beneath is far darker—and far more clever—than any traditional whodunit.
Just when you think you’ve figured it out, the movie pivots and throws you completely off track. The twists are bold, shocking, and laced with biting social commentary.
4. Oldboy (2003)
Director: Park Chan-wook
Genre: Neo-noir / Revenge Thriller
Country: South Korea
This South Korean cult classic doesn’t just have one of the best plot twists in foreign cinema—it has one of the most disturbing and unforgettable revelations in movie history. The film’s intensity, its stylistic action sequences, and the emotional weight all build up to a climax that leaves you absolutely shaken.
It’s violent, tragic, and haunting—and the twist will hit you like a gut punch.
5. The Prestige (2006)
Director: Christopher Nolan
Genre: Mystery / Sci-Fi / Drama
A story about two rival magicians might sound simple, but in the hands of Christopher Nolan, it becomes something else entirely. The Prestige is layered with deception, obsession, and ambition. The film itself is a magic trick, and just like any good illusion, the final reveal is both brilliant and deeply satisfying.
It’s not just a twist—it’s a lesson in narrative misdirection.
6. The Others (2001)
Director: Alejandro Amenábar
Genre: Gothic Horror / Mystery
Starring Nicole Kidman, The Others is a slow-burn ghost story with a dark, moody atmosphere. What makes it stand out, though, is how it toys with perspective. By the time the truth is revealed, the emotional impact is just as powerful as the surprise itself.
It’s a film that rewards patience and leaves you with chills long after the credits roll.
7. Arrival (2016)
Director: Denis Villeneuve
Genre: Sci-Fi / Drama
At first glance, Arrival might seem like a typical alien-contact film. But it’s not about invasion or action—it’s about communication, time, and memory. The narrative plays with structure and perception, culminating in a twist that redefines the story’s purpose and delivers an emotional blow you won’t see coming.
It’s smart, moving, and one of the most mature science fiction films of the last decade.
8. Shutter Island (2010)
Director: Martin Scorsese
Genre: Psychological Thriller
With Scorsese at the helm and Leonardo DiCaprio in the lead, Shutter Island is an eerie descent into psychological turmoil. As a U.S. Marshal investigates a disappearance at a mental institution, clues build slowly—until the explosive reveal flips the entire narrative upside down.
It’s a masterclass in misdirection, and the twist is both devastating and brilliant.
9. Primal Fear (1996)
Director: Gregory Hoblit
Genre: Courtroom Thriller / Drama
This underappreciated gem features Edward Norton in a breakout role that earned him an Oscar nomination. What begins as a straightforward courtroom drama soon transforms into something far more sinister.
The twist is subtle, yet utterly chilling—one that changes the way you see not just the film, but the character at its heart.
10. Coherence (2013)
Director: James Ward Byrkit
Genre: Sci-Fi / Mystery / Indie
A low-budget indie with a huge payoff, Coherence is a mind-bending story about parallel realities that spiral out of control during a dinner party. What makes the twist so effective is how grounded the film feels despite its complex premise.
It’s one of those hidden gems that proves a compelling idea can outshine even the biggest budget—and the final act will leave your brain spinning.
What Makes a Great Plot Twist?
Not all twists are created equal. The best plot twists don’t exist just to shock—they serve the story, deepen the characters, and feel inevitable in hindsight. When crafted well, a plot twist:
- Is built into the narrative through subtle clues
- Surprises without cheating the audience
- Changes the context of everything that came before
- Invites rewatching or deeper reflection
A great twist makes you want to go back and analyze what you missed. It turns a passive viewing experience into an interactive one.
